my 92 buick started making a dinging sound as if the door was ajar and the break light stays on mostly apon accelleration, tends to stop dinging and break light goes out apon slowing way down or applying breaks??? my emergency break is not stuck and all break lights on outside of car are in good shape, im so confused of what this could possibly be??someone, anyone please advise me in some sort of direction. thanks.

Re: 92 buick makes a dinging sound and break light stays on
I would have someone check the brake fluid level and if good look for a wire making and breaking (loose connection ect.),possibly at the emergency brake switch for starters,good luck.

I had the same thing happen with my 95 Lesabre. I had the brake fluid checked and they said it was fine. But the car still kept dinging. They finally had to replace the brake fluid sensor and that solved the problem.
